Age: 36-43 Skin: Oily, Fair-Medium, Warm Hair: Blond, Straight, Fine Eyes: Blue
not quite HG, but close enough to make me happy. this is pretty cheap as it is, but i found it for half off at Ulta a couple times, so got it for under 5 bucks -- just look around for sales there and at Walgreen's.
i'm on my third bottles of this, and i use it in the morning under my sunblock/moisturizer as a treatment. this makes my face look more even-toned, rested, and smooth -- and this i'm sure of, because when i finished my first bottle, i noticed i didn't look quite as lively in the morning, which is what prompted me to buy a second bottle. most products don't yield any noticeable changes on my skin, because my skin isn't wrinkled or inelastic. so, i'm always thrilled to find something that works, esp. if it's cheap.
the packaging is superb -- a handy pump ensures product freshness. it does tend to occasionally squirt out too much until you learn how hard to press to get just the right amount; thus, i took off one star for packaging.
the only other downside is the smell - it gets old after awhile. it's too strong, and too sweet, almost citrusy.
try this if you're looking for a nice, cheap drugstore buy that renders quick results. please note my skin is oily and acne-prone, and this did not exacerbate either condition.
